ESN is Hiring a Project Estimator Near Naperville, IL

We are seeking a Construction Estimator to join out team in Lemont, IL!

This role will be focused on estimating projects from Ground up, Commercial, Civic, Education, Retail, Healthcare, Industrial, Government, and multi-family.

· Project Values: $50,000 - $3M

· Competitive Compensation and Benefits Package

· Fun and supportive culture of employees

· Strong pipeline of projects through 2024 leading into 2025

Responsibilities:

  • Ability to read and understand Project Drawings, Details, and Specifications
  • Ability to manage & complete bid processes, seeing the proposal process from start to finish
  • Perform quantity take-offs on our Take -Off Program (eTakeoff)
  • Input take-offs into our estimating program and manage pricing as directed to create bids
  • Manage subcontractor quotes and contracts
  • Working with General Contractor's and performing scope reviews
  • Communication with General Contractors for RFI’s, Schedules, and winning project
  • logical and organized approach to completing tasks and solving problems
  • Must have a strong & motivated work ethic
  • Proficient in MS Office, Adobe and plan viewing applications
  • Bluebeam)
  • Inputting new/updated unit pricing into our estimating system
  • Ability to update and clean up eTakeoff and Estimating programs

Qualifications

· 2-5 years of experience in construction estimating

· Experience working in landscape construction is a plus

· Must be decisive and work well under pressure

· Strong ability to concurrently manage multiple construction projects across various markets

· General understanding of civil, architectural, and other construction drawings is required

· Familiarity with computers and software programs for job costing, online collaboration, scheduling,and estimating is required. Must be proficient in MS Office and MS Project

· Strong negotiation, problem solving, and conflict resolution skills required
